Audio Hijack Pro updated to 2.9


Rogue Amoeba's great audio recording software Audio Hijack Pro has been updated to 2.9 and features a more polished user interface with better ID3 tagging and artwork for MP3 recordings. Hijack Pro is a very capable and easy to use audio recorder for capturing audio from any source on a Macintosh, or from external line or microphone inputs. Key features of Audio Hijack Pro:
  • Able to use VST and AU plugins (comes with it's own as well as any you have installed). These effects can be flexibly organised using a matrix style grid allowing you to create and save unique recording setups.
  • Captures audio from web browsers, Skype, DVD, applications, Web radio streams etc.
  • Quick recording bin allows for fast set up and recording.
  • Records to pretty much all the main audio file types directly. AIFF, MP3, AAC, Lossless AAC, etc. all fully customisable.
  • Able to schedule recordings and split a file or pause when silence occurs.
  • Can grab all system audio from all applications into one file.
  • Good metering and can be controlled via Applescript
  • Works with Fission a separate lossless editor if required or you can point Hijack Pro to edit using your preferred application (e.g. Audacity, Wave Edit, etc.)
  • 50 effects plugins included from 4FX and Steve Harris (LADSPA compatible as well as VST and AU).
